Transaction 75708ce279738658ff3f1dbbcedb8563048cf4a48b13b61b9f704c1ddd86762f

2 Input
2 Outputs
  • 75708ce279738658ff3f1dbbcedb8563048cf4a48b13b61b9f704c1ddd86762f:0
  • value  1243273
    address  1EiwAWZDebKkjw1DCbdnqHEDmTwEspSDtv
  • 75708ce279738658ff3f1dbbcedb8563048cf4a48b13b61b9f704c1ddd86762f:1
  • value  13686933
    address  3KKoRmv6Uf7iuay5hYKMTWebzBFMKwQVnC